August weather forecast
Ouargaye, Burkina Faso

August

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is another tropical month in Ouargaye, Burkina Faso, with an average temperature varying between 23.3°C (73.9°F) and 31.3°C (88.3°F).

Temperature

August, having an average high-temperature of 31.3°C (88.3°F) and an average low-temperature of 23.3°C (73.9°F), is the coldest month.

Heat index

For most parts of August, the heat index is computed to be an extremely hot 40°C (104°F). Additional precautions are required to avert heat cramps and heat exhaustion. Persistent activity may culminate in heatstroke.
Research indicates the heat index considers values in shaded locales and with light winds. Direct exposure to sunlight could raise the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', embodies the combination of air temperature and moisture content to illustrate perceived heat. This effect is personal, shaped by the individual's physical activity and heat sensitivity, influenced by factors including wind, clothing, and metabolic variances. Keep in mind that direct sunshine exposure can amplify the weather's effects, possibly increasing the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ly critical to babies and toddlers. Young individuals usually face more risks than adults due to their lower sweat production. Their large skin surface area relative to their tiny bodies and high heat production from their activities adds to their risk.
Humans rely on perspiration as a cooling mechanism, wherein the evaporating sweat counteracts excessive warmth. Under conditions of increased relative humidity, the evaporation rate lessens, causing the body to retain more heat than under less humid conditions. When heat uptake goes beyond the body's cooling mechanisms, there's a surge in body temperature, posing health risks.

Humidity

The most humid month is August, with an average relative humidity of 74%.

Rainfall

August is the month with the most rainfall. Rain falls for 19.5 days and accumulates 114mm (4.49")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 12h and 29min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:47 and sunset at 18:24.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 05:49 and sunset at 18:10 GMT.

Sunshine

In Ouargaye, the average sunshine in August is 9.7h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in August is 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
